About the role

This position is part of a 12-month Graduate and Early Career Program, focused on developing capability through structured supervision and learning. The new Graduate Art Therapist will be responsible for delivering and contributing to art therapy interventions and therapeutic groups within the Mental Health and Wellbeing Locals.

Please refer to the Position Description for more information.

- Facilitate group art therapy sessions in consultation with consumers, ensuring alignment with recovery-focused, trauma-informed and client-centred frameworks
- Provide 1:1 art therapy session under supervision, where clinically appropriate and within scope of practice
- Assist with planning and facilitation of therapeutic art therapy groups for consumers
- Document and report findings, observations, goals, and actions from art therapy sessions
